When you see successful entrepreneurs on television, in magazines and newspapers, and on podcasts, what do you see? Do you see all of the hard work and sacrifice they have made to get to where they are in their business and life? Often, what we see is only 10% of the full success story. You see the positive things, but typically not the negative.

 

In this episode, I explain the Iceberg Illusion and why it’s important to remember all of the things that are beneath the surface of every entrepreneur. I share my success story - including the 90% you don’t see - and explain how you can use this knowledge to motivate and push yourself to continue your journey despite the challenges and obstacles you may face.

 

“What you see is only 10%. What you don’t see is the 90% below the surface.” - Sigrun
